[drag n drop] Enable middle-mouse-button behavior for right-mouse-button
Last modified: 2021-06-18 15:29:48 UTC
Followup from https://bugzilla.gnome.org/show_bug.cgi?id=320286#c9 The title says it all, as right-click drag and drop has no particular purpose for now, and middle-click drag n drop is not very discoverable (or even not possible on some touchpads), please enable the same behavior (allow choosing between copy/move/link on mouse button release) for the right-mouse-button drag n drop.
